[發明專利]一種安裝應用軟件的方法、裝置及電子設備在審
| 申請號: | 201510981123.2 | 申請日: | 2015-12-23 |
| 公開(公告)號: | CN105630551A | 公開(公告)日: | 2016-06-01 |
| 發明(設計)人: | 王辰汐 | 申請(專利權)人: | 北京金山安全軟件有限公司 |
| 主分類號: | G06F9/445 | 分類號: | G06F9/445;G06F21/57 |
| 代理公司: | 北京市廣友專利事務所有限責任公司 11237 | 代理人: | 祁獻民 |
| 地址: | 100085 北京*** | 國省代碼: | 北京;11 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 安裝 應用軟件 方法 裝置 電子設備 | ||
1.一種安裝應用軟件的方法,應用于客戶端,其特征在于,該方法包括:
接收服務端下發的應用軟件預下載指令;
檢測所述客戶端上是否安裝有所述應用軟件預下載指令對應的應用軟件;
若無,則按照預設策略在所述客戶端上下載并存儲所述應用軟件安裝包;
當在所述客戶端上預先設置的應用軟件下載場景中觸發了所述預下載指令 對應的應用軟件的下載安裝請求時,直接調用已經下載的應用軟件安裝包進行 安裝。
2.根據權利要求1所述的方法,其特征在于,所述按照預設策略在所述客 戶端上下載并存儲所述應用軟件安裝包包括:
檢測是否存儲有安裝所述應用軟件的應用軟件安裝包;如果沒有存儲所述 應用軟件安裝包,下載并存儲所述應用軟件安裝包。
3.根據權利要求1所述的方法,其特征在于,所述應用軟件預下載指令是 由存儲有各安全應用軟件安裝包的云端服務器按照預先設置的時間周期,在預 先設置的推送時間點向存儲的電子設備庫中各電子設備下發的,所述應用軟件 預下載指令中包含有安全應用軟件安裝包標識信息。
4.根據權利要求3所述的方法,其特征在于,獲取所述推送時間點包括:
向存儲的電子設備庫中各電子設備下發鎖頻時間段獲取請求;
統計接收的各電子設備上報的鎖頻時間段,將統計的鎖頻時間段出現頻率 最高的時間段作為所述推送時間點。
5.根據權利要求1所述的方法,其特征在于,所述方法進一步包括:
設置用于展示下載速度以及下載進度的下載管理器,以后臺方式下載并存 儲所述應用軟件安裝包;
接收用戶的下載查詢請求,調用所述下載管理器并在所述下載管理器中展 示下載速度以及下載進度。
6.根據權利要求1至5任一項所述的方法,其特征在于,所述下載并存儲 所述應用軟件安裝包包括:
檢測電子設備是否處于鎖屏狀態;
如果電子設備處于鎖屏狀態,檢測電子設備的網絡狀態;
如果電子設備處于無線仿真網絡狀態,從發送所述應用軟件預下載指令的 云端服務器下載所述應用軟件安裝包;
在下載所述應用軟件安裝包完畢后,存儲所述應用軟件安裝包。
7.根據權利要求6所述的方法,其特征在于,所述方法進一步包括:
在存儲所述應用軟件安裝包時,為存儲的所述應用軟件安裝包設置下載未 完成標識,并記錄已下載的所述應用軟件安裝包中片段的片段標識;
如果所述應用軟件安裝包下載完成,刪除已下載的所述應用軟件安裝包中 的片段標識以及下載未完成標識。
8.根據權利要求7所述的方法,其特征在于,在所述記錄已下載的所述應 用軟件安裝包中片段的片段標識之后,所述方法進一步包括:
在網絡連接重新啟動后,獲取設置有下載未完成標識的應用軟件安裝包, 依據記錄的片段標識以及總片段標識,確定未下載的片段并下載。
9.根據權利要求2所述的方法,其特征在于,在所述如果沒有存儲應用軟 件安裝包之后,下載并存儲所述應用軟件安裝包之前,所述方法進一步包括:
掃描電子設備是否存在漏洞,如果存在漏洞,執行所述下載并存儲所述應 用軟件安裝包的步驟。
10.根據權利要求9所述的方法,其特征在于,在所述如果存在漏洞之后, 執行下載并存儲所述應用軟件安裝包之前,所述方法進一步包括:
將電子設備的類型信息以及操作系統信息上報,以便于云端服務器根據上 報的所述電子設備的類型信息以及操作系統信息獲取對應的應用軟件安裝包。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于北京金山安全軟件有限公司,未經北京金山安全軟件有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201510981123.2/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種電池管理系統初始化的方法和裝置
- 下一篇:一種補丁程序安裝方法及裝置





